Docman are no strangers to supporting local and national charities and this month we are pleased to donate £535 to the Prince of Wales Hospice.

Docman-Prince-of-Hospice-Cheque

The donation is the second from the company in the year, following a company initiative where for each employee completing an employee satisfaction survey the company would make a donation to the Prince of Wales Hospice.  The charity provides palliative care and support for patients with life-limiting illnesses and their families.

Employing over 100 local people, Docman is a leading provider of software to the NHS by digitising paper, letters and documents that would previously be handled and moved around.
